Benedict Jacka (born 25 September 1980) is a British author, best known for his Alex Verus series. [1]
Jacka was born in England and attended the City of London School. He later attended Cambridge University, where he graduated with a Bachelors in philosophy and met his editor Sophie Hicks from Ed Victor Ltd. [2] His first novels were three children's fantasy novels that didn’t get published, followed by To Be A Ninja (later changed to Ninja: The Beginning), a children's non-fantasy novel, which was. In 2000 he began working on a fantasy setting with teenage elementals, for which he wrote four unpublished novels. In 2009, he decided to try again with an adult character and a more information-based ability. [3] Three years later, in 2012, he published the first book of the Alex Verus series, two more followed the same year. [4] Jacka married in 2015 to Rolari Kuti. [5]
Critical reception for Jacka's work has been mostly positive. [6] [7] Of the Alex Verus series, SF Site has cited the series' characters and chapter cliffhangers as highlights. [8] [9] SF Crowsnest gave an overall positive review for Cursed, while stating it was "an enjoyable, if unchallenging, read". [10]
In June 2021 Jacka released "Favours", a novella which takes place between books 6 and 7; [11] in October 2022 he released "Gardens", a novella which takes place after book 12. [12]
